What the record shows

The Embraer 195 is the stretched first generation E-Jet and has never had a fatal accident. One aircraft has been written off: an Air Serbia service operated by Marathon Airlines that overran the runway on takeoff from Belgrade in February 2024, struck ground installations and returned to land, with no injuries among the 111 people on board. Only 172 were built, so this variant has the smallest exposure base in the family and the widest statistical uncertainty.
